Workout and Extending Techniques



To stop injuries throughout fighting styles training, it's important to appropriately heat up your body and execute reliable extending methods.

Start with some light cardio exercises like jogging in place or jumping jacks. This will enhance your heart price and prepare your body for the upcoming training session.

Next off, concentrate on dynamic extending to enhance versatility and series of activity. Do movements like leg swings, arm circles, and upper body spins. Dynamic stretching aids to trigger your muscles and avoids them from obtaining strained during training. Remember to hold each go for only a few seconds and avoid bouncing, as this can bring about muscular tissue splits or strains.

Appropriate Method and Kind



After warming up and extending, it's essential to concentrate on correct strategy and kind in order to protect against injuries throughout martial arts training.

Taking notice of your method and form can make a considerable difference in lowering the threat of injury. Here are 5 key points to bear in mind:

- Keep a solid and secure stance, distributing your weight equally.
- Maintain your core involved and your body aligned to guarantee appropriate balance and security.
- Implement techniques with precision and control, preventing unneeded strain on your muscular tissues and joints.
- Concentrate on correct breathing techniques to boost endurance and stop muscular tissue stress.
- Pay attention to your body and stay clear of pushing past your limitations, gradually raising strength and difficulty with time.

Recuperation and Rest Strategies



Taking ample time for recuperation and remainder is critical in preserving a healthy and balanced and injury-free martial arts educating routine. After intense training sessions, your body needs time to repair and recoup. It's during this period that your muscular tissues rebuild and reinforce, permitting you to enhance your efficiency gradually.

Make certain to include day of rest into your training routine to offer your body the moment it requires to recover. Furthermore, focus on getting sufficient rest each evening as it plays an essential function in recuperation. Sleep is when your body repair work damaged cells and releases development hormonal agents.
